SESC Pompeia Chair by Lina Bo Bardi , 2022, Marcenaria Baraúna

About the Item

Design:Lina Bo Bardi, Marcelo Ferraz, André Vainer Material:Laminated Pine Designed by Lina Bo Bardi in 1986, this chair was designed for the library and dining room in the SESC Pompeia Cultural Center, a cultural facility in the São Paulo Pompei area. This is the first reissue in the world by CASA DE. For the "SESC Pompeia Cultural Center" project, Lina designed not only the building, but also the furniture, the staff uniforms, graphics, and everything else. The design is a collaboration between Lina Bo Baldi, Marcelo Fejas, and André Vayner, and is made up of four planks of wood made from layers of different colored woods. The chair has a wonderful brutalist design that brings the charm of the wood to life.

    Design:Francisco Fanucci Material:Solid Wood Stool designed by Francisco Fanucci in 1988. It is designed around the theme of "sentar brasileiro brazilian seating". It is said to have been inspired by the stools used in the Brazilian countryside to keep warm by a wood stove, a traditional indigenous craft. The angle of the wood on the seat allows the stool to fit and support the body in a position similar to a squatting posture. Small and practical, it can be placed by the fireplace or used as an entryway...
